Ace spinners Kuldeep Yadav and Yuzvendra Chahal are having a stellar IPL season up till now and are taking wickets for their side on a regular basis now. Both of them are on top of the wicket-taking leaderboard in the 15th edition of the cash-rich league.

On Thursday, Kuldeep showed the fans why he is such a mystery bowler and on his day, can get crucial wickets at times. He returned with 4/14 runs in three overs to derail his former franchise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R). His tally of wickets for the season now stands at 17 from eight games.

When asked about his competition with Yuzvendra Chahal, Kuldeep Yadav asserted that the former is like a ‘big brother’ and wants him to win the Purple Cap. Speaking at the post-match presentation ceremony, the Delhi Capitals spinner said:

“There has never been competition with him (Chahal). He has encouraged me a lot. He has been like a big brother and stood by me during my bad times. In my heart, I want him to go and win the Purple Cap because he has been bowling exceptionally over the past four years.”

Both Kuldeep Yadav and Yuzvendra Chahal have the utmost respect for each other and have supported each other through thick and thin. Even though both of them play for different franchises, the main goal is to make sure that they both excel whenever their team needs them to step up and deliver.


“I don’t get scared of failing now” – Kuldeep Yadav

The 27-year-old further said the last two years have made him mentally stronger. Kuldeep also added that he is not scared of failing anymore which has made him a better bowler.

“I might have become a better bowler, but I am mentally stronger than before. When you fail in life you pick what you can improve on and that is something I had to improve. I don’t get scared of failing now,” added the star spinner.
